| Rule | Requirement | Validation |
|---|---|---|
| ❌ No new files without reuse analysis | Search codebase, reference files that cannot be extended, provide exhaustive justification | Before creating: "Analyzed X, Y, Z. Cannot extend because [technical reason]" |
| ❌ No rewrites when refactoring possible | Prefer incremental improvements, justify why refactoring won't work | "Refactoring X impossible because [specific limitation]" |
| ❌ No generic advice | Cite file:line, show concrete integration points, include migration strategies |
Every suggestion includes file:line citation |
| ❌ No ignoring existing architecture | Load patterns before changes, extend existing services/components, consolidate duplicates | "Extends existing pattern at file:line" |

Fast Track (bug fixes, small changes):
- [ ] Load current month README: `memory-bank/tasks/YYYY-MM/README.md`
- [ ] Check recent achievements and next priorities
- [ ] Load `quick-start.md` if needed
Standard Discovery (features, tests, quality-critical work):
- [ ] Current month README
- [ ] Core files: projectbrief.md, systemPatterns.md, techContext.md, activeContext.md, progress.md
- [ ] Scan docs/ for recent updates
- [ ] Scan root for instructions.md, ai_instructions.md
- [ ] Verify toc.md and activeContext.md current
Deep Dive (architecture, legacy investigation):
- [ ] Standard Discovery files
- [ ] Specific month README when investigating legacy
- [ ] decisions.md for architectural context
- [ ] Cross-reference with current work patterns

States: PLAN → BUILD → DIFF → QA → APPROVAL → APPLY → DOCS
Substates: CODING (building), WAITING_TOOL (permissions), RUNNING (QA), IDLE
PLAN [approve] → BUILD → DIFF → QA [pass] → APPROVAL [approve] → APPLY → DOCS → END
↑ ↑______↓______↓_____[fail/changes]______________↓
└───────────────────────────────────[major changes needed]─────┘

Retry Protocol:
- 1st fail: Analyze output, minimal fix, re-test
- 2nd fail: Re-analyze approach, check environment, fix, re-test
- 3rd fail: STALL DETECTED → request user input or agent swap

**Budgets**: Cycles: 3/3 ⚠️ | Tokens: 85K/100K | Minutes: 28/30 ⚠️Context Zones:
- Core (always): Task contract, relevant MB files, current state
- Task (current task): Files being modified, direct dependencies, related tests
- Reference (on-demand): Arch patterns, similar implementations, historical decisions
Context Rotation: After each state transition, drop Task Context, reload only what's needed for next state. Keep Core Context persistent.
Parallel Execution:
Task decomposition:
1. [Independent A] - parallel
2. [Independent B] - parallel
3. [Dependent C] - requires A+B
Execution: Spawn parallel agents for A+B with focused context → Wait → Execute C with results

Checklist:
- Auth/Authz: No hardcoded creds | Auth checked before sensitive ops | Authz at boundaries | Session mgmt follows patterns
- Data Handling: Input validation on external data | Output encoding prevents injection | Sensitive data encrypted (rest/transit if applicable)
- Error Handling: No sensitive data in errors | Errors logged appropriately | Graceful degradation
- Dependencies: No known vulnerabilities | Versions pinned | Licenses compatible
If any item fails, address before APPROVAL state.
Requirements: Zero errors before APPROVAL | Warnings OK with justification | Follow project's linting rules
Standards: Language idioms | Consistent naming (from projectRules.md) | Single-purpose functions | Max 3-4 nesting levels | Comment complex logic only
Coverage: Unit tests for all new functions | Integration tests for workflows | Edge case coverage for critical paths | Clear test names
Quality: Deterministic (no flaky tests) | Independent (no shared state) | Fast (optimize slow tests) | Maintainable (clear, readable)

Rollback Triggers: APPLY fails | User requests revert | Critical error | Security vulnerability
Rollback Protocol:
- Identify last known good state
- Restore all files to that state
- Verify rollback successful
- Log rollback in operational log
- Report to user: reason, reverted changes, current state, recommendation

| Issue | Symptoms | Resolution |
|---|---|---|
| Loop | Same diff multiple times, QA fails repeatedly, no progress after 3+ cycles | Check budgets → Load more MB → Clarify requirements → Check environment → Agent swap |
| Context Exceeded | Token limit approaching, slow/truncated responses, forgetting earlier info | Rotate context (drop Task, reload essentials) → Focused mode (MB summaries only) → Break into subtasks → Agent swap |
| CI ≠ Local | QA passes, CI fails | Compare environments → Verify dependency versions → Check timing/concurrency → Check state cleanup → Document waiver if CI issue |
| Security Fail | Security checklist incomplete, sensitive data exposed, auth/authz bypassed | Never bypass → Return to BUILD → Fix all issues → Re-test → Document pattern if new |

Full Reset (complete breakdown):
- Log current state
- Discard uncommitted changes
- Reset to last known good state
- Start new session with fresh agent
- Load MB in full (Standard Discovery)
- Re-analyze with fresh perspective
Partial Rollback (recent regression):
- Identify last working state
- Rollback only problematic changes
- Keep working changes
- Re-test to verify stability
- Continue from DIFF or BUILD
Agent Swap (capability mismatch):
- Complete current state (clean boundary)
- Document progress in operational log
- Prepare focused context: task contract, relevant MB files, current work state
- Spawn specialized agent with focused context
- Let specialized agent complete subtask
- Integrate results back into main workflow
